Installing iPod 4th Generation or Photo Headphone Jack Bracket: Step 1 Before opening your iPod, ensure that the hold switch is in the locked position. The orange bar should be visible, indicating hold is active. /Guide/Installing-iPod-4th-Generation-or-Photo-Headphone-Jack-Bracket/389/all#s4111 Installing iPod 4th Generation or Photo Headphone Jack Bracket: Step 2 Opening the iPod can be challenging. Don't get discouraged if it takes you a few tries before the iPod is opened. Insert a large iPod opening tool into the seam between the plastic front and metal rear panel of the iPod, near the headphone jack. The tool's edge should point towards the metal rear panel to prevent any accidental scratching of the plastic front. Run the tool along the top seam toward the upper left corner of the iPod. You may be able to free the tabs by gently wiggling the front panel of the iPod. /Guide/Installing-iPod-4th-Generation-or-Photo-Headphone-Jack-Bracket/389/all#s4116 Installing iPod 4th Generation or Photo Headphone Jack Bracket: Step 7 The iPod case is now open, but don't separate the two halves just yet. There is still an orange ribbon cable connecting the headphone jack to the logic board. Open the case like a book with the dock connector edge at the top, and lay the rear panel next to the front half of the iPod. /Guide/Installing-iPod-4th-Generation-or-Photo-Headphone-Jack-Bracket/389/all#s4117 Installing iPod 4th Generation or Photo Headphone Jack Bracket: Step 8 Use a plastic tool or your fingernails to carefully disconnect the orange headphone jack cable. Be sure to pull straight up on the connector, not the cable itself. /Guide/Installing-iPod-4th-Generation-or-Photo-Headphone-Jack-Bracket/389/all#s4118 Installing iPod 4th Generation or Photo Headphone Jack Bracket: Step 9 Remove the 2 silver T6 Torx screws from the headphone jack. /Guide/Installing-iPod-4th-Generation-or-Photo-Headphone-Jack-Bracket/389/all#s1645 Installing iPod 4th Generation or Photo Headphone Jack Bracket: Step 10 Remove the 3 silver Philips screws securing the headphone jack to the rear panel. /Guide/Installing-iPod-4th-Generation-or-Photo-Headphone-Jack-Bracket/389/all#s1646 Installing iPod 4th Generation or Photo Headphone Jack Bracket: Step 11 Grasp the white headphone jack bracket and lift it out of the iPod. /Guide/Installing-iPod-4th-Generation-or-Photo-Headphone-Jack-Bracket/389/all#s1647
